Output d952001231f079bb4fcf72f10a76282c5e254a0bfddc39749a24e21efba940d0:1

value
2884218
script pubkey
OP_0 OP_PUSHBYTES_32 90b996aabaa855a4c5d40e0361c29f10504d8fedcd93da603138dac8014a14d3
address
bc1qjzued2464p26f3w5pcpkrs5lzpgymrldekfa5cp38rdvsq22znfswwxqgj
transaction
d952001231f079bb4fcf72f10a76282c5e254a0bfddc39749a24e21efba940d0